Agents welcome AirAsia’s KL-New Delhi route

AGENTS in Malaysia expressed delight that AirAsia X will recommence four-weekly flights from Kuala Lumpur to New Delhi from February 3, 2016, saying the increased capacity will help them better develop packages.

AirAsia X had suspended the route four years ago in order to improve operating core efficiencies and consolidate its network.

The announcement is also timely as Malaysia Airlines has halved the frequency on its twice-daily Kuala Lumpur-New Delhi route on September 1.

Arokia Das, senior manager at Luxury Tours Malaysia, said: “It will be easier to promote Malaysia as a mono destination and not in combination with Singapore. Currently, many are flying to Singapore before taking a connecting flight to Kuala Lumpur as this is a more affordable route compared to taking direct flights to Kuala Lumpur.”

“The extra capacity is also welcomed especially during the peak Indian travel season during the summer and winter school holidays,” added Das.

Another agent, Nanda Kumar, managing director of Hidden Asia Travel & Tours, said the low fares and promotional offers by the LCC will help stimulate outbound travel to New Delhi and the golden triangle packages of Delhi-Agra-Jaipur, especially during the school holiday period.
